The active ingredient of WINREVAIR, sotatercept-csrk, is a recombinant activin receptor IIA-Fc (ActRIIA-Fc) fusion protein that improves pro-proliferation (ActRIIA/Smad2/3-mediated) and anti-proliferation (BMPRII/Smad1/5/8-mediated) signals, thereby regulating vascular proliferation. In March 2024, WINREVAIR was approved by the U.S. Food and Drug Administration for the treatment of pulmonary arterial hypertension (PAH) in adults. Clinical studies have shown that WINREVAIR can improve exercise capacity and reduce the incidence of all-cause death or clinical worsening of PAH by 84%. Common adverse drugreactions include headache, epistaxis, rash, etc.
